About the Course

This is the sixth course in the Google Data Analytics Certificate. You’ll learn how to visualize and present your data findings as you complete the data analysis process. This course will show you how data visualizations, such as visual dashboards, can help bring your data to life. You’ll also explore Tableau, a data visualization platform that will help you create effective visualizations for your presentations. Current Google data analysts will continue to instruct and provide you with hands-on ways to accomplish common data analyst tasks with the best tools and resources. Learners who complete this certificate program will be equipped to apply for introductory-level jobs as data analysts. No previous experience is necessary. By the end of this course, learners will: - Understand the importance of data visualization. - Learn how to form a compelling narrative through data stories. - Gain an understanding of how to use Tableau to create dashboards and dashboard filters. - Discover how to use Tableau to create effective visualizations. - Explore the principles and practices involved with effective presentations. - Learn how to consider potential limitations associated with the data in your presentations. - Understand how to apply best practices to a Q&A with your audience....
